Our voice lies at the intersection of
talent (your natural gifts and strengths),
passion (things that naturally energise, excite, motivate and inspire you),
need (including what the world needs enough to pay you for), and
conscience (that still voice within that assures you of what is right and prompt you to actually do it).

A. Set Your Priorities
A. Set Your Priorities
Two factors define an activity:
Urgent and Important
Urgency: Urgent activities require immediate attention (they act on you)
Importance: Important activities require initiative or proactivity (you must act on them)
